Biography: 
Simon Singh grew up in Somerset, and completed his undergraduate work at Imperial College London, and his Ph.D. at Cambridge University and CERN. He has worked with the BBC's Science Department since 1990. In 1996, Singh directed the award-winning documentary "Fermat's Last Theorem". The documentary was also nominated for an Emmy under the American title "The Proof". He is the author of three books, including, "Big Bang", a history of cosmology. His first book, "Fermat's Last Theorem", was the first book about mathematics to become a No.1 bestseller in the UK.
